Britannica's helm is a Scottish encyclopedia that was regarded as an information period that gave Scotland a sense of pride through the enlightenment. During this era, industrialization crept in and, as a result, brought forth revolutionary objectives. The Britannica encyclopedia was first considered an arts and sciences dictionary from the 1768 partnership of Colin Macfarquhar and Andrew Bell.

If I were at the helm of Britannica, I would have kept the cost of purchasing the physical Britannica version high to gain more profit from the sales. People still bought the physical version even after publishing the digital version through CDs that was cheaper. Therefore, portraying a low elasticity demand as they were willing to incur high costs to get that version.
